I have a Manfrotto 535K legs/504HD head combo for my 4.9kg (11lb) BMPCC rig. One crucial thing I need though, is to be able to horizontally mount the entire rig at 90 degrees (flip the camera onto its side) while maintaining full pan/tilt capability for a film I'm shooting. One way to cheat it is to rotate the baseplate 90 degrees and then and vertically tilt 90 degrees, but then I don't have proper pan/tilt control. Also, the rig would be off the tripod's centre of gravity and only held there by a single 3/8" thread. What's the best way to do this without the whole thing hanging off a single thread, and having full pan/tilt control as normal? Any help would be massively appreciated - thanks!
